Jump to content

Slavnik

Members
  • Posts

    18
  • Joined

  • Last visited

Everything posted by Slavnik

  1. Ну DCS позволяет управлять всем просто через "джойстик". Протокол TrackIR больше актуален для ИЛ2. Там через "джойстик" только повороты можно назначить. Хотя в конфигных файлах есть вроде возможность смещения поставить на оси, но игра похоже эти настройки игнорирует. И разработчики где-то на форуме это подтверждали. Может щас что изменилось? В общем, для ИЛ2 и пришлось колупаться с dll-кой. А потом оказалось что нестандартная dll не нравится античитам. Правда я понял это не в ИЛ2, а в DayZ. Пришлось делать службу.
  2. А причем здесь Оупентрек? Это отдельное USB-устройство, определяется в Windows как стандартный джойстик с 5 осями, если ничего дополнительно не загружать. Если установить дополнительно разработанную мною системную службу, работает по протоколу FreeTrack 2.0, т.е. распознается играми как TrackIR. Сам использую в DCS и IL2. Но хотелось-бы отзывы сторонних пользователей: что удобно, что нет и т.п. Можно даже и службу не ставить, может все работать через мои dll-ки, заменяющие стандартные библиотеки TrackIR, но тогда античиты их режут. На DCS и IL2 античитов вроде нету (Или есть? Я по сети не играю), а вот в шутерах это проблема.
  3. Понятно. DMP трекингу смещений никак не помогает.
  4. Спасибо, посмотрел. А тогда зачем гироскопы вообще нужны? Ведь "компас" с "отвесом" и так дадут полную ориентацию по вращению. Продольные ускорения башки и магнитные возмущения отфильтровывать? Кстати, еще вопрос - в спецификации MPU-9250 упомянута такая вроде-бы встроенная туда система: Digital Motion Processor (DMP). Не в курсе с чем это едят? Он не помогает более точной работе с трекингом?
  5. Согласен с вышеизложенным. Только есть вопрос - а как достигается отслеживание продольных перемещений в ТВ-пультах и 3D шлемах? Датчики лучше или математика? Кстати, в IMU если применять одни "гироскопы" и акселерометры, без "компаса", и повороты-то отслеживать затруднительно. Хотя теоретически они на одних "гироскопах" должны работать.
  6. У меня на левой педальке сломался этот крючок пару лет назад, на правой недавно. Клеить отломанную пластмаску вроде бесполезно - долго держать не будет. Смог сделать накладку на родную деталь повторяющую крючок с помощью эпоксидки и туалетной бумаги . Первая держится уже два года, вторая пару недель. Если вопрос еще актуален могу расписать как. Можно было-бы сфоткать, но разбирать и снимать деталь не хочу - сильно задалбывает натягивать пружину. После возни во второй раз склоняюсь к мысли что тоже-самое проще и быстрее было-бы сделать из "холодной сварки".
  7. Отдам безвозмездно на тестирование 5-ти осевой оптический инфракрасный трекер в надежде на обратную связь при проверке функционирования в различных играх.. Комплект включает основной модуль + "рога" с ИК диодами. Основной модуль работает на ARM-процессоре обрабатывающем данные с цифровой камеры. Модуль подключается в качестве USB-устройства и определяется в Windows как стандартный джойстик с 5 осями не требуя драйверов и дополнительных программ. В DCS этого достаточно, т.к. игра поддерживает управление взглядом и смещениями через оси джойстика. При запуске специально разработанной системной службы работает по протоколу FreeTrack 2.0, т.е. распознается играми как TrackIR. Таким образом может использоваться в ИЛ2 и других играх. Программное обеспечение в комплекте. "Рога" подключаются к питанию через разъем USB, что позволяет использовать либо гнездо компьютера, либо пауэрбанк или зарядник для телефона. Основной модуль размещается на мониторе или немного позади. Объектив чувствителен только к ИК засветкам, т.е. не воспринимает свет обычных бытовых осветительных приборов. "Рога" закрепляются на голове горизонтально сверху примерно так:
  8. А что именно интересует? Пока тестирую в DCS и ИЛ2. Доработал фильтрацию. Есть проблема в ИЛ2 - игра не дает управлять перемещениями в кабине через оси джойстика, приходится работать через опентрек в режиме джойстик-freetrack.
  9. Интересная мысль. Хорошо бы кто-нить, кто уже копался, поделился опытом.
  10. Когда камера далеко, для повышения точности надо увеличивать размер рамки. Если даже опентрек не позволяет произвольно задавать размер, можно попробовать увеличить рамку сохранив старые пропорции. Не реализованы поперечные наклоны головы. За ненадобностью. Но их можно вставить. Работает только как джойстик. А как еще нужно? Как Track IR? Это вряд-ли - там вроде собственный закрытый и шифрованный протокол.
  11. Как я понял, мысль в том, чтобы связать модуль который работает как джойстик с инерционником и избежать вообще работы с опентрэком? Такую систему в принципе возможно сделать, но зачем ее гибридизировать с рамкой? При оптической работе с рамкой инерционник не нужен - тут уже считываются свои угловые перемещения, а если при инерционнике все равно присутствует рамка - теряется вся его прелесть. Так что в гибриде скорее сложатся не преимущества а недостатки. Сейчас же вроде сделали два инерционника которые дают продольные-поперечные? Кстати, а инерционник с опентрэком грузит систему тоже на 8%? С ним вроде некоторая сложность калибровки есть? Калибровки на всю жизнь хватает или она периодична? Подумаю. Смотря какой интерес будет. Пока тут все высказывания в духе "А на хрена это?":)
  12. Так в 12 году зачем купил? Был-же opentrack с камерой Sony PS3?
  13. Да, нагрузка небольшая. А зачем люди тогда Track IR покупают?
  14. Наверно основной смысл обойтись без программной обработки и почти не нагружать систему, еще может быть меньше возни для пользователя с настройками. Сам лет 10 назад летал с Фритрэком и рамкой, но вроде полного 6 dof добиваться не удавалось, уже не помню точно почему.
  15. Модуль камеры OV7670. Управляющий микропроцессор SAM7S256 на отладочной плате собственной разводки заказанной у китайцев (так дешевле).
  16. Демонстрация работы 5-осевого оптического трекера:
×
×
  • Create New...